Mount Gilead added another win to their season total on Friday when they improved to 13-6 (9-3 in league play) with a 69-36 win over Elgin.

The Indians dominated the early stages of the game, taking a 23-7 lead after one period of play and a 45-18 lead into the half. The score was then 62-27 after the third quarter as MG cruised to the win.

Four players hit double figures for Mount Gilead, as Tyler Bland tallied 18 points, Zack Hosack added 14, Deondre Cook finished with 12 and Mason Mollohan had 10.

Cardington Pirates

Cardington was able to top Fredericktown on Friday night by a score of 62-52.

The game was deadlocked in its early stages, with both teams scoring 13 points in the first quarter. However, the Pirates jumped in front by a 32-23 margin at the half. The Freddies got within a 43-38 margin after three quarters, but Cardington pulled away down the stretch to win by 10.

Devin Pearl had five three-pointers on his way to a 22-point game, while Derek Goodman added four three-pointers and wound up with 14 points on a night when he was honored for scoring 1000 points in his high school career. Also, Trey Williams added 10.

Highland Scots

Highland jumped out to a fast start against East Knox and picked up a 49-30 win on Friday.

The Scots went up 17-5 after the opening period. Both teams scored 16 points over the middle two quarters, but Highland took the fourth by a 16-9 score to pull away for the decisive win.

Alex Mason hit four three-pointers on his way to tallying 16 points, while Quin Winkelfoos added 10 more.

Highland wouldn’t be able to make it two wins on the weekend, though, as Pleasant topped them 53-27 on Saturday. The Spartans jumped out to a 15-6 lead after the first quarter and led 26-10 at the half. They would go on to take the second half 27-17 to continue adding to their lead.

Both Mason and Winkelfoos finished with seven points.

Northmor Knights

Centerburg pulled away late to earn a 69-55 win over Northmor Friday night.

The Knights played the Blue Division leading Trojans closely for much of the game, trailing 15-14 after the first quarter, 24-20 at the half and 46-40 at the end of the third. However, Centerburg took the fourth 23-15 to expand their lead into double digits.

For Northmor, Brock Pletcher hit four three-pointers in finishing with 16 points, while Tyler Kegley added 14 and Gunner Lilly scored 13. He hit three three-pointers in the contest.
